- Robert F. Kennedy Jr. will be sworn in as the U.S. Secretary of Health and Human Services, focusing on initiatives from his "Make America Healthy Again" campaign.
- His agenda includes reducing chronic diseases, promoting healthy eating, and enhancing food safety, while addressing concerns from pharmaceutical and food industries regarding his influence.
- Analysts suggest that his policies may benefit grocery chains like Kroger, Albertsons, and Amazon's Whole Foods, as he aims to increase transparency and accountability in the food and pharmaceutical sectors.
